Palmeira Café, Bar & Deli reflects the strong Portuguese café and deli culture woven throughout parts of London's residential neighborhoods over several generations.

Portuguese cafés operate differently from more stylized modern coffee shops because they function simultaneously as cafés, bakeries, bars, lunch spots, and informal community gathering spaces throughout the day. Espresso sits beside beer taps, pastries beside grilled meats, football broadcasts beside conversations stretching lazily across long afternoons. Food leans heavily into comfort and accessibility, bifanas, pastries, deli sandwiches, grilled dishes, soups, cured meats, and strong coffee designed for repetition.
